#9198ab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9198ab is composed of 56.9% red, 59.6%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.2% cyan, 11.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 223.8 degrees, a saturation of 13.4% and a lightness of 62%. #9198ab color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#233157.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#9198ab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9198ab has RGB values of R:145, G:152, B:171 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 9541803.

Shades and Tints of #9198ab
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9198ab
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989ba4 is the less saturated color, while #3f72fd is the most saturated one.
